Information portal for sustainable securities Series of workshops on sustainability topics for listed companies ![]() The stocks & standards workshop ‘The importance of sustainability in the context of capital market communication of exchange-listed companies: niche or mainstream?’ took place in February 2013. The stocks & standards workshops were developed for issuers, companies considering an exchange listing and Deutsche Börse Listing Partners. The workshops cover a multitude of standard and current topics regarding going & being public. More Sustainability dialogue “Promoting transparency for holistic investment strategies” ![]() Deutsche Börse and the Carbon Disclosure Project hosted a sustainability dialogue on 21 November 2012 at The Photographers’ Gallery in London where they invited buy-side clients as well as representatives from not-for-profit organisations, banks, exchanges and other market players to discuss the significance of environmental, social and governance aspects (ESG) in investment decisions. More Carbon Disclosure Project Report 2011 presentation ![]() For the third consecutive year, Deutsche Börse hosted the presentation of the Carbon Disclosure Project Report 2011 for Germany and Austria. The report aims at promoting the establishment of emissions management and climate change as important economic and success factors of companies. Global Reporting Initiative stakeholder event ![]() Deutsche Börse Group hosted the Global Reporting Initiative (GRI) G4 workshop. The GRI sees itself primarily as a platform and initiator for an ongoing international dialogue of various stakeholders in society, politics and the economy. Training course ‘Qualified Supervisory Board (QAIF)’ ![]() The training course certified by Deutsche Börse Group prepares participants for the Qualified Supervisory Board member exam. The topics relevant for the final exam include, among others: organisation and management of the supervisory board, corporate strategy and management, operational risk management, compliance and auditing, financing and investment as well as corporate governance and corporate social responsibility. | |
